To the incoming director: this memo summarises the inventory write-down approved last quarter at our Thornhaven distribution centre. Obsolete stock of the Gaveston fixture range was written down by 38%, reflecting a discontinued supplier agreement and weak seasonal demand. Controls have been tightened on reorder thresholds. The confidential note on our forward plans follows immediately below.

confidential, kagup-bafog: Fraaxax Group is in early talks to buy Soroxox Group for about $343.8 million. The Olidor launch date is June 14, and nothing goes to the press before then. Legal wants the Aldmirek Logistics term sheet signed before July 23.

# Artifact Signing — Splitwell Assignment Service

All Splitwell release artifacts must be signed before promotion to staging. Build the tarball with `make dist`, then sign with the team tooling. Unsigned artifacts are rejected by the deploy gate automatically. Contractors use the shared signing identity until personal keys are provisioned. The current signing key follows.

rollout seal: bky4_DFM9

Subject: Log sampling enabled for Chatterline

Team — starting with this release, the Chatterline ingest service samples its debug logs at 1-in-50 instead of writing every line. The service was producing more log volume than the rest of the Hollowgate stack combined. Error and warn levels are still unsampled, so alerting is unaffected. If you need full-fidelity logs for a repro, request an override and reference the build below.

session token of tajef-bageg = htk21_5d90d574934f3ccae6437

Handover — Vexler partner SFTP drop

Ownership moves to you today. Drop runs hourly from Vexler's end into the intake bucket via the relay host. Watch for zero-byte files; their exporter flakes on Mondays. Creds live in the ops vault, path noted in the runbook. Vault auto-seals after 48h idle. Support escalations go to the on-call rotation, not me. If the vault is sealed when you need it, unseal with the recovery passphrase below.

recovery phrase for tadug-fafof: zorwyn-kasion